The implementation of object handoff in overlapping fields of view is one of the key techniques of continual object tracking in multi-camera tracking systems.Feature matching methods and the algorithm based on field of view are adopted in conventional solutions towards this problem.However,FM is not practical in application because it is not computationally efficient and the results heavily depend on the parameter settings of the cameras.The approaches based on FOV suffer from the delay of the detection of newly appeared objects,causing the results of consistent labeling are not reliable.Recently,projective invariants method is used to handoff object,but it will make mistakes in the case of multiple objects appear closely.The paper proposes a novel scheme for object handoff based on projective invariants and histogram matching.The experimental results show that our method could solve the problem above.
